Inquiry scope
In this session the Committee will examine the Department for Transport’s work on rail, including the Integrated Rail Plan and other infrastructure projects, the future of rail reform, and steps to resolve industrial action and to improve recent poor service, especially in the north of England.Oral evidence sessions
